columns().order()
使用 columns() API 方法应用多列排序。
- 作者:艾伦·贾丁
- 需要:DataTables 1.10+
此插件提供一种方法来确定一个或多个列的可搜索状态,该状态已通过 columns.searchable
选项进行配置。
使用
可以通过多种不同的方式获得和使用此插件。
浏览器
此插件在 DataTables CDN 中提供
JS
然后,此插件将自动针对全局 DataTables 实例进行注册。如果您正在使用 AMD 加载器(例如 Require.js),也可以使用该文件。
请注意,如果您使用多个插件,则将插件组合成一个文件并在您自己的服务器上托管它会更有助于提高性能,而不是向 DataTables CDN 发出多个请求。
NPM
所有插件都可以在 NPM 上获得(也可以与 Yarn 或任何其他 JavaScript 包管理器一起使用)作为 datatables.net-plugins
包的一部分。要使用此插件,请首先安装插件包
npm install datatables.net-plugins
ES 模块
然后,如果您正在使用 ES 模块,请导入 datatables.net
、您需要的其他 DataTables 扩展程序和插件
import DataTable from 'datatables.net';
import 'datatables.net-plugins/api/column().searchable().mjs';
CommonJS
如果您正在使用 CommonJS 加载器来加载 Node(例如较旧版本的 Webpack 或非模块 Node 代码),请使用以下方法来 require
插件
var $ = require('jquery');
var DataTable = require('datatables.net');
require('datatables.net-plugins/api/column().searchable().js');
示例
// Get the searchable flag for all columns
table.columns().searchable().toArray()
// Get the searchable flag for column index 0
table.column(0).searchable()
版本控制
如果您有任何改进此插件的想法,或发现任何错误,请在 GitHub 上使用此插件,欢迎提交请求!
- 此插件:column().searchable().js
- 完整 DataTables 插件存储库:DataTables/Plugins